Is there an option to create folders sub folders in Power BI service

We have a requirement to segregate the Reports in the Power BI service. 

 

Can anyone please let me know as I could not find the option to create folders in Power BI Service?

Creating folders within a workspace isn't feasible . You may  switch to lineage view which shows reports grouped on datasets they use. While publishing apps you may group them in Navigation .

This issue is resolved now. In March 2024 release, Microsoft has introduced an option to create a folder in workspace to organise your PowerBI items. 

Note - It is in public preview so there are some limitations but Microsoft team is working on it.

Note - Now this option is not in Public preview and this feature is available on Power BI service. 

To create a folder in a Power BI workspace, click on workspace in the Power BI service, click "+ New", and select "Folder". Give the folder name and click "Create".

Now you can move/add power BI items like report, semantic model inside this folder. You can follow same process to create sub folder.
